Stina Fisch is a young artist and illustrator from Luxembourg who is known for her clever reinventions of people portraiture. Her portraits have been featured regularly in the weekly ‘d’Land’. She also enjoys inventing new creatures and new forms and has done several books for children, company campaigns, record sleeves, even stamps and mural drawings. The Luxembourg artist is the first Luxembourg resident at Youkobo Art Space. It is also her first visit to Japan and she records her impressions daily (please consult her blog on www.stinafisch.com ). When she’s not busy inventing new beasts and telling scurrilous stories, Stina also works at MUDAM (Museum of Modern Art) Luxembourg.
